FE3F hexadecimal to binary




Here we will show you how to convert the hexadecimal number FE3F to a binary number. First note that the hexadecimal number system has sixteen different digits (0 1 2 3 4 5 6 7 8 9 A B C D E F) and the binary number system has only two different digits (0 and 1).


The four steps used to convert FE3F from hexadecimal to binary are explained below.

Step 1)
Multiply the last digit in FE3F by 16⁰, multiply the second to last digit in FE3F by 16¹, multiply the third to last digit in FE3F by 16², multiply the fourth to last digit in FE3F by 16³, and so on, until all the digits are used.

F × 16⁰ = 15
3 × 16¹ = 48
E × 16² = 3584
F × 16³ = 61440

Remember that the hexadecimal number system has sixteen different digits, so when doing the above calculation, we use the following values if applicable: A=10, B=11, C=12, D=13, E=14, and F=15.

Step 2)
Next, we add up all the products we got from Step 1, like this:

15 + 48 + 3584 + 61440 = 65087

Step 3)
Now we divide the sum from Step 2 by 2. Put the remainder aside. Then divide the whole part by 2 again, and put the remainder aside again. Keep doing this until the whole part is 0.

65087 ÷ 2 = 32543 with 1 remainder
32543 ÷ 2 = 16271 with 1 remainder
16271 ÷ 2 = 8135 with 1 remainder
8135 ÷ 2 = 4067 with 1 remainder
4067 ÷ 2 = 2033 with 1 remainder
2033 ÷ 2 = 1016 with 1 remainder
1016 ÷ 2 = 508 with 0 remainder
508 ÷ 2 = 254 with 0 remainder
254 ÷ 2 = 127 with 0 remainder
127 ÷ 2 = 63 with 1 remainder
63 ÷ 2 = 31 with 1 remainder
31 ÷ 2 = 15 with 1 remainder
15 ÷ 2 = 7 with 1 remainder
7 ÷ 2 = 3 with 1 remainder
3 ÷ 2 = 1 with 1 remainder
1 ÷ 2 = 0 with 1 remainder

Step 4)
In the final step, we take the remainders from Step 3 and put them together in reverse order to get our answer to FE3F hexadecimal to binary:

FE3F hexadecimal = 1111111000111111 binary
